Output 85a5fe76795fa3975cfc60ff03f6c508a2e959aa158c6e136d42ee52400bdd01:0

value
3622556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 217133ec3d0964245a4a89744cfc5cf613648003 OP_EQUAL
address
34jqqLvDehFHuJDmAFZpAd5ti5JDaSPjNW
transaction
85a5fe76795fa3975cfc60ff03f6c508a2e959aa158c6e136d42ee52400bdd01
spent
true